Yuri Chuchmay, born in Tyumen, Russia, is a highly skilled freelance concept artist and illustrator, celebrated for his contributions to dark fantasy, sci-fi, and horror genres. His education under the renowned artist Leo Hao helped shape his artistic style, and in 2017, he gained recognition by winning the prestigious Kuzinsky art contest.

That served him well after returning to Oakland to start a freelance career that would last for more than fifty years. Jim soon understood not only that he could carve a professional niche for himself by specializing in lettering; it was also his life’s calling. He had an incredible knack for rendering any kind of letter style by hand.
